Instantly creates a wide, natural stereo image by playing different samples on the left and right channels.

848 MB of high-definition 16-bit / 44.1kHz audio samples.

To capture the ideal sound, Amplitube offers various microphone models. Users can choose from different microphones and adjust their positioning to achieve the perfect tone.

Use a high-quality convolution room reverb to simulate the natural environment of an acoustic recording studio.
